Precast Concrete RV pads?

Ok...I am a beginner RV buyer, so I thought I had checked everything on zoning laws about having the travel trailer parked on my son's rental house property, but now found out that I need a "continuous concrete pad". Please don't send me messages about "Well you should have done this or you should have done that", because I know I messed up and I am trying to fix the situation the best I can. I am looking into ordering a Pre-cast concrete pad so that it won't be permanent and I can just break it into pieces and remove it, if they ever move, I will then just have to fix the grass underneath...has anybody ever done anything like this before? What is the price? What are any pitfalls? I need a 16x10 pad.

41 Replies

  • You will not be able to get that "pre-cast" all in one piece.....unless maybe you pay a TON of money for it; would have to be set with a crane.

    "Continuous" does not mean without seams though and you might do it in sections.

    The ONLY way I would do this is get written permission of the property owner that includes LEAVING IT IN PLACE if you stop using it for any reason. And then pay a concrete contractor to pour it.
